Victoria's Youth Mentoring Programs: A Overview to Existing Options

Finding the right young people's mentoring program in Melbourne can feel challenging. Several wonderful organizations deliver structured guidance to help adolescents reach their aspirations. These include Big Brothers Big Sisters, that focuses on one-on-one relationships, and Mentor Australia, offering a broader variety of support. Besides, there are local groups like The Smith Family, which a more comprehensive approach including academic assistance and personal development. Investigating each program's criteria and dedication levels is important before applying . You can discover a thorough list on the Youth Services platform or by contacting the City of Melbourne council directly.

Melbourne's Youth Support Landscape : What Are On Offer ?

Melbourne offers a thriving NDIS youth programs melbourne array of youth mentoring programs, catering to various needs and goals. Numerous organizations, like Big Brothers Big Sisters, Mentor Assist, and The Smith Family, run structured mentorship , connecting young individuals with positive adult figures . Beyond these types of formalized initiatives, local groups and educational institutions frequently host informal mentoring opportunities. Furthermore , online portals are developing, presenting virtual support options for young people , especially in distant areas. Exploring this broad landscape can be tricky, but resources like Youth Gateway & the Department of Families, Fairness and Housing website offer valuable information to find the best support.
